]> git.droids-corp.org - dpdk.git/blobdiff - drivers/net/qede/qede_ethdev.c
eal: clean up interrupt handle
[dpdk.git] / drivers / net / qede / qede_ethdev.c
index 2f1d2b517121d9d64f24188bf07c97f93bc8ad7f..5f469e56fbff53fae8f79a6f2b62119343bd78f3 100644 (file)
@@ -279,14 +279,14 @@ static void qede_interrupt_action(struct ecore_hwfn *p_hwfn)
 }
 
 static void
-qede_interrupt_handler(struct rte_intr_handle *handle, void *param)
+qede_interrupt_handler(void *param)
 {
        struct rte_eth_dev *eth_dev = (struct rte_eth_dev *)param;
        struct qede_dev *qdev = eth_dev->data->dev_private;
        struct ecore_dev *edev = &qdev->edev;
 
        qede_interrupt_action(ECORE_LEADING_HWFN(edev));
-       if (rte_intr_enable(handle))
+       if (rte_intr_enable(eth_dev->intr_handle))
                DP_ERR(edev, "rte_intr_enable failed\n");
 }